Jordan Harrison is a 5-foot-6 guard in NCAA Division I women’s basketball, listed as an active senior for West Virginia in the NCAAW. Born in Oklahoma City, Oklahoma, she wears No. 10 and started all 34 games in the 2025 regular season, logging 1,069 minutes (31.4 per game) in a high-usage backcourt role.
In 2025, her Jordan Harrison stats show 447 points for a 13.1 Jordan Harrison scoring average, along with 5.2 assists, 3.24 steals, and 3.26 rebounds per game. She shot 45.0% from the field, 53.0% on two-pointers, 30.2% from three, and 83.8% at the free-throw line, posting a 0.572 true shooting percentage. Harrison added 178 assists against 95 turnovers for a 1.87 assist-to-turnover ratio, and recorded 110 steals on the year, a standout defensive metric for a perimeter player.
Her 2025 postseason sample includes two games with 13.0 points and 6.0 assists per game, and a three-game conference tournament stretch at 15.3 points per game while shooting 46.9% from the floor and 100% on free throws.
